-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
java基础测试0919
JAVA基础 专 业 学 历 就读院校 联系电话 QQ Email 计划参加几月培训 申请测试时间 目前所在地
填写完毕后请认真完成以下题目,并发给咨询老师!
以下测试题中Q1—Q10为不定项选择题,请将你认为正确答案的序号填写在如下相应的答题卡内。Q11—Q15为简答题,在将正确答案填写在答题卡上之后,务必在相应的问题处写出必要的计算过程。
1 2 3 4 5 6 7 8 9 10 计算题:
11、
12、
13、
14、
15、
Q1. 哪些是合法的 java 标示符?
A.2variable B. variable2 C. _whatavariable D. _3_ E. $anothervar F. #myvar
Q2. ?
A. public int a[]
B. static int[] a
C. public[] int a
D. private int a[3]
E. private int[3] a[]
F. public final int[] a
Q3. 运行?
public class Test{
public static void main(String[] args){
string foo=”blue”;
string bar=foo;
foo=”green”;
System.out.println(bar);
}
}
A. 抛出异常
B. 编译出错.
C. 打印“null”
D. 打印“blue”
E. 打印“green”
Q4.
public class Q {
public static void main(String argv[]){
int anar[]= new int[5];
? System.out.println(anar[0]);
}
}
A. Error: anar 没有被初始化
B. null
C. 0
D. 5
Q5. 下面的程序片断中
String a = “ABCD”;
String b = a.toLowerCase();
b.replace(‘a’, ‘d’);
b.replace(‘b’,’c’);
System.out.println(b);
编译运行结果是什么?
abcd
ABCD
dccd
dcba
编译错误
运行时抛出异常
Q6.
你想一个类存取同一个包中的另一个类中成员,哪一个存取修饰符限制的最严格?
public
private
protected
transient
不需要任何修饰符
Q7. 4.break中断语句,若在一个FOR语句中加入break语句,它可以________
A、对FOR语句执行没有影响 B、中断本次循环,进入下一次循环
C、退出FOR循环,执行FOR语句后面的语句 D、以上说法均不对
Q8. 代码:
int i =1,j =10;
do {
if(i++ --j) {
continue;
}
} while (i 5);
System.out.println(“i = “ +i+ “and j = “+j);
运行结果是什么?
A. i = 6 and j = 5
B. i = 5 and j = 5
C. i = 6 and j = 5
D. i = 5 and j = 6
E. i = 6 and j = 6
Q9. 下列程序段的输入结果是( )
String str=”helloworld!”;
System.out.println(str.subString(5,8));
A、wor B、owo C、owor D、worl
Q10. 代码:
for (int i =0; i 4; i +=2) {
System.out.print(i + “”);
}
System.out.println(i);
结果是什么?
A. 0 2 4
B. 0 2 4 5
C. 0 1 2 3 4
D. 编译错误.
E. 运行的时候抛出异常
Q11.现有两个骰子,一共有多少种方法可以掷出骰子点数之和是7?有多少种方法可以掷出点数之和小于等于6?(写出必要的计算过程)
点数之和是7个骰子骰子骰子点数之和个骰子骰子骰子点数之和个骰子骰子骰子点数之和个骰子骰子骰子点数之和个骰子骰子骰子点数之和个骰子骰子骰子点数之和掷出点数之和小于等于6
Q12. 当B等于Y时,A等于Z;当A不等于Z时,E要么等于Y,要么等于Z,所以
A.当B等于Y时,E既不等于Y也不
原创力文档


文档评论(0)